When starting on the journey of home purchasing, recognizing one's budget and funding choices is essential. Purchasers have to first assess their economic situation, consisting of income, savings, and existing financial obligations, to develop a sensible budget plan. Luxury Real Estate for Sale. This budget plan will dictate the price array for potential homesNext, purchasers should explore different financing choices, such as standard car loans, FHA financings, or VA car loans, each with one-of-a-kind needs and advantages. Contrasting rate of interest and terms from various lending institutions can considerably affect total prices.
In addition, understanding down payment demands and closing costs is necessary, as these can differ extensively. Buyers ought to likewise consider their credit report, as it influences lending qualification and rate of interest.

Comprehending the prospective mistakes in a home assessment can considerably improve a buyer's experience. Common inspection problems typically consist of structural issues, such as foundation splits or water damages, which can signify deeper worries. Electrical and plumbing systems may also provide difficulties, with obsolete wiring or leaking pipelines resulting in costly repair services. Purchasers frequently ignore the relevance of roofing problem; missing shingles or indications of wear can suggest unavoidable substitute requirements. Additionally, pest infestations, specifically termites, can jeopardize a home's integrity. Insulation and air flow problems might go undetected, affecting power effectiveness and indoor air high quality. By knowing these common inspection issues, customers can make enlightened choices and negotiate repair work or price adjustments efficiently, making sure a smoother home-buying procedure.Working With Certified Assessors

What Are the Hidden Prices of Acquiring a Home?
The covert expenses of purchasing a home often consist of real estate tax, upkeep costs, insurance coverage, shutting expenses, and prospective house owner association fees. Recognizing these variables is crucial for potential buyers to spending plan effectively and prevent economic surprises.The length of time Does the Home Acquiring Refine Commonly Take?
The home getting process commonly takes about 30 to 45 days, although numerous elements such as funding, assessments, and settlements can extend this timeline. Purchasers should be gotten ready for prospective hold-ups during this period.Should I Think About New Construction or Existing Residences?
